Fee Structure And Facilities

Very affordable institution, lower fee for every course as compare to the other institutions. I am doing BSc my fee is Rs 3500 per year for three years it is Rs 11500 and exam fee Rs120 per paper.

Exam Structure

Some times we are very tired because we have do all the lab activities in between 7-15 days depends upon the credits. Regular students do these lab exercises over the year but we have to do in one to two weeks.
